在現(xiàn)代科技飛速發(fā)展的背景下,人工智能(AI)視覺檢測技術(shù)已經(jīng)成為許多行業(yè)的核心組成部分。特別是在實時數(shù)據(jù)處理方面,這項技術(shù)展示了巨大的潛力和應(yīng)用前景。從自動駕駛到智能安防,從制造業(yè)的質(zhì)量檢測到醫(yī)療影像分析,AI視覺檢測的實時數(shù)據(jù)處理能力正逐漸改變我們的生活和工作方式。那么,AI視覺檢測如何實現(xiàn)高效的實時數(shù)據(jù)處理呢?下面將從幾個關(guān)鍵方面進(jìn)行詳細(xì)探討。

數(shù)據(jù)采集與傳輸?shù)膬?yōu)化

AI視覺檢測的實時數(shù)據(jù)處理首先依賴于高效的數(shù)據(jù)采集和傳輸。在實際應(yīng)用中,圖像傳感器和攝像頭的選擇至關(guān)重要?,F(xiàn)代高分辨率攝像頭可以快速捕捉高質(zhì)量的圖像數(shù)據(jù),確保檢測系統(tǒng)能夠獲取到足夠的信息進(jìn)行分析。為提高數(shù)據(jù)傳輸?shù)乃俣群头€(wěn)定性,許多系統(tǒng)采用了先進(jìn)的壓縮技術(shù)和高帶寬傳輸協(xié)議。例如,工業(yè)相機(jī)常用的GigE Vision和USB3 Vision接口,能夠支持快速的數(shù)據(jù)傳輸,從而減少延遲。

除了硬件的優(yōu)化,數(shù)據(jù)采集過程中也需要處理數(shù)據(jù)傳輸中的瓶頸。為此,很多系統(tǒng)采用邊緣計算技術(shù),將數(shù)據(jù)處理任務(wù)下放到接近數(shù)據(jù)源的邊緣設(shè)備上,這樣可以減少數(shù)據(jù)傳輸?shù)难舆t,提升實時處理的效率。邊緣計算不僅減輕了中心服務(wù)器的負(fù)擔(dān),也提高了系統(tǒng)的響應(yīng)速度。

AI視覺檢測如何實現(xiàn)實時數(shù)據(jù)處理

高效的圖像處理算法

在數(shù)據(jù)采集之后,如何高效處理這些圖像數(shù)據(jù)是實現(xiàn)實時數(shù)據(jù)處理的關(guān)鍵。AI視覺檢測系統(tǒng)通常依賴于深度學(xué)習(xí)和計算機(jī)視覺算法來完成圖像分析任務(wù)。近年來,卷積神經(jīng)網(wǎng)絡(luò)(CNN)在圖像分類和目標(biāo)檢測方面表現(xiàn)出了卓越的性能。通過對海量圖像數(shù)據(jù)進(jìn)行訓(xùn)練,CNN能夠自動提取圖像中的特征,并進(jìn)行準(zhǔn)確的分類或定位。

為了進(jìn)一步提升處理速度,研究人員不斷優(yōu)化這些算法的結(jié)構(gòu)和計算方式。例如,輕量級網(wǎng)絡(luò)結(jié)構(gòu)如MobileNet和EfficientNet已經(jīng)被提出,這些網(wǎng)絡(luò)在保持高準(zhǔn)確率的顯著減少了計算量和內(nèi)存占用,從而提高了實時處理的能力。通過硬件加速(如使用GPU或TPU)也能顯著提升算法的執(zhí)行效率,確保系統(tǒng)能夠在短時間內(nèi)處理大量數(shù)據(jù)。

系統(tǒng)架構(gòu)與資源調(diào)度

AI視覺檢測系統(tǒng)的實時性能還依賴于系統(tǒng)架構(gòu)的合理設(shè)計。在實際應(yīng)用中,系統(tǒng)架構(gòu)包括數(shù)據(jù)采集模塊、數(shù)據(jù)處理模塊和結(jié)果輸出模塊。為了實現(xiàn)實時處理,這些模塊之間需要高效地協(xié)作。許多系統(tǒng)采用了并行處理技術(shù),通過將任務(wù)分解成多個子任務(wù)并行執(zhí)行,來提升整體處理效率。

資源調(diào)度也是確保系統(tǒng)實時性的一個重要方面。系統(tǒng)需要有效管理計算資源,如CPU、GPU的利用率,以及內(nèi)存的分配。例如,實時操作系統(tǒng)(RTOS)通常被用于處理時間敏感的任務(wù),通過精確的任務(wù)調(diào)度和優(yōu)先級管理,確保關(guān)鍵任務(wù)能夠按時完成。負(fù)載均衡技術(shù)可以幫助分配計算任務(wù),避免系統(tǒng)過載或資源浪費,從而提高整體處理效率。

實時反饋與動態(tài)調(diào)整

實時數(shù)據(jù)處理不僅需要高效的處理和傳輸,還需要能夠?qū)μ幚斫Y(jié)果做出快速反應(yīng)。在許多應(yīng)用場景中,系統(tǒng)需要根據(jù)實時分析結(jié)果做出動態(tài)調(diào)整。例如,在自動駕駛中,視覺檢測系統(tǒng)需要實時識別道路標(biāo)志、行人和障礙物,并根據(jù)這些信息調(diào)整車輛的行駛路線和速度。

為了實現(xiàn)這種動態(tài)調(diào)整,系統(tǒng)需要具備快速的反饋機(jī)制。通常,這包括將處理結(jié)果及時反饋到控制系統(tǒng),并根據(jù)反饋調(diào)整操作策略。這種反饋機(jī)制通常依賴于快速的通信協(xié)議和實時控制算法,以確保系統(tǒng)能夠在最短時間內(nèi)響應(yīng)外部環(huán)境的變化。

AI視覺檢測實現(xiàn)實時數(shù)據(jù)處理的能力涉及多個方面,包括數(shù)據(jù)采集與傳輸?shù)膬?yōu)化、圖像處理算法的高效性、系統(tǒng)架構(gòu)的合理設(shè)計以及實時反饋機(jī)制的有效性。通過不斷優(yōu)化這些方面,AI視覺檢測系統(tǒng)能夠在各種復(fù)雜應(yīng)用場景中表現(xiàn)出優(yōu)異的實時性能。未來的研究可以進(jìn)一步探索如何結(jié)合新興技術(shù),如量子計算和5G通信,來進(jìn)一步提升系統(tǒng)的實時處理能力,以應(yīng)對更加復(fù)雜的應(yīng)用需求。